Bear Market Patterns Suggest We Could Have Hit Bottom
Looking back at Bitcoin’s recent history, this bear run began around October and November – strikingly paralleling the previous downturn from late 2021 to mid-2022. Those past cycles lasted roughly eight months before prices stabilized and entered an accumulation phase that eventually led to a sharp, nearly tenfold rise.
While history doesn’t guarantee the future will match, the similar timeline is compelling. If Bitcoin and the broader market follow the prior trajectory, we may already be seeing the end of this bear cycle and the start of a slow buildup in investor interest.
